A Warner's publicity still of an incredibly sultry-looking Ann Sheridan, aka "The Oomph Girl"! I think Ann is one of the most underappreciated actresses of her era. She had style to burn and made any film she appeared in better just by being in it! Some films that really showcase her talents are "Juke Girl", "It All Came True", "City for Conquest" and "Torrid Zone", where she nearly stole the show from all including James Cagney and Pat O'Brien!

Barbara Stanwyck in a publicity still for William Wellman's classic "Lady of Burlesque". Babs also made "So Big", "The Purchase Price" and "Great Man's Lady" with Wellman

Ida Lupino in a publicty shot for Warner's excellent drama "The Man I Love". Ides was yet another one of those actresses who had started at another studio but really found her niche at Warner Bros.
